EMPRESS THEATRE.

"The Other Half" will be screened for the last time at the Empress Theatre today. To-morrow's bill offers Sessue Hayakawa in "An Arabian Knight." It is said that for sheer beauty of settlings and acting this is one of the most remarkable pictures of the year. It is a story that breathes the very atmosphere of Egypt, the P/Vramide, and the harems. In the picture Hayakawa's excellent dramatic work will be shown again, but in addition there will be a new Hayakawa, who is seen in the extremes of light comedy and heavy drama.
